Chapter 156 - Can We Still Have a Face?

Three rounds of wine later…

"Students, these here are all the competitors from the Continental Soul Master Academy Elite Competition five years ago."

Qin Ming tipped his wine jar toward the group, a proud smile playing on his lips. "Back then, I won the championship with them!"

"Teacher Qin Ming, you're wrong!" A drunken student lurched to his feet with all the seriousness of a philosopher, words slurring. "You led them to the championship!"

"What?" Qin Ming blinked, caught off guard. "I followed them to the championship."

He remembered it vividly—his role back then was barely more than contributing… well, a little noise from the sidelines. Yet somehow, victory was theirs.

God, that feeling had been incredible. That was how he'd become the Director of Teaching.

"Yan Yan, you're here buying wine for the old poisonous man," Lu Yuan slurred, leaning into the girl at his side. "How's that old poisonous man doing now? Haven't seen him for years… I'm worried… Oh—and the medicinal herbs!"

"My grandpa's doing just fine!" Dugu Yan mumbled, nestled lazily in Lu Yuan's arms, her words half-dreamy. "He's been managing the medicine garden all these years, and lots of new herbs have started sprouting."

"That's great! I'll go see the old poisonous man for myself," Lu Yuan declared suddenly. "Actually, I could use something from his medicine garden."

Swaying to his feet, he said over his shoulder, "Teacher Qin Ming, we'll be heading off first! Oh, and tell Old Man Meng I took two bottles of wine for him."

With that, the slightly drunken Lu Yuan led Dugu Yan and the other two girls out of the tavern.

By the time Qin Ming paid the bill and stepped outside, most of the alcohol haze had lifted. Watching Lu Yuan disappear into the distance, an odd unease stirred inside him.

These past five years had been good for him professionally, but… never once had he met a prodigy Soul Master quite like Lu Yuan. Was that fortunate or unfortunate? He wasn't sure.

What he was sure of was this: if he were to take his current group of students to the next Continental Soul Master Academy Elite Competition, they'd be crushed.

Not that it mattered now—the rampaging evil spirit masters had put an end to that tournament entirely.

Sunset Over the Forest

A damp, eerie chill rushed in on the evening breeze, causing Lu Yuan to involuntarily shiver.

"The road's still far," he muttered.

Almost as if summoned, a flash of green whisked past, and Dugu Bo appeared right in front of them.

"Old man poison," Lu Yuan grinned, greeting him with casual mockery, "you've gotten a lot taller since I last saw you."

Dugu Bo stared at him wordlessly.

"I heard from Yan Yan you've been visiting the medicine garden lately—let's go, I want to take a look." Without waiting, Lu Yuan staggered toward the direction of the garden.

"You brat, I knew you didn't come here to see me." Dugu Bo blew out his beard in irritation. He'd planned on asking where Lu Yuan had been all these years—now he didn't even need to bother.

"Old poison, why are you blocking me? I'm going to my medicine garden," Lu Yuan complained.

"Yours?!" Dugu Bo barked. "Lu Yuan! Can we still have a face?" This was the first time in his long life he'd seen someone flip truth inside out so shamelessly.

"Old man poison, stop pretending! That medicine garden is Yan Yan's dowry for the future. I only asked you to tend it for a few years, but now you act like it's your own." Lu Yuan didn't pause his stride. "If you don't let me through, I'll tell Yan Yan not to support you in your old age."

Excessive! Absolutely excessive!

"Yan Yan, don't hold me back today! I'm going to teach this stinky brat a lesson—otherwise you'll be bullied the day you marry him!" Dugu Bo's patience snapped.

The arrogance, the utter lack of reason!

"Old poisonous man, your skin's itching again?" Lu Yuan sneered. If the old man wanted a fight, was he supposed to say no?

"Fine! If you can get past me today, you can take whatever herbs you want from the garden," Dugu Bo growled, his temper flaring.

"Grandpa, you…"

"Goose, don't worry. Grandpa knows what he's doing." Dugu Bo cut his granddaughter off firmly. Today, he would teach this brat respect.

"Grandpa… you might not be able to beat him," Dugu Yan tried, biting back a sigh. She already knew Lu Yuan's strength, especially after seeing him duel Bone Douluo. Even Bone Douluo hadn't gained an advantage—her grandfather might fare worse.

"You've got a fever, girl?" Dugu Bo pressed a palm to her forehead. Was she seriously saying something so ridiculous? How strong could Lu Yuan possibly be? A Soul Saint? Even if he were, Dugu Bo wouldn't lose to him—his surname might as well be Lu Yuan if that happened!

"Old man poison, no backing out now!" Lu Yuan warned, his hand sliding behind him to grip the sword hilt.

The moment he drew it, three arcs of Sword Qi erupted toward Dugu Bo.

Chi! Chi! Chi!

Powerful spirit energy burst from Dugu Bo's palm, blocking the sword strikes head-on. His eyes narrowed—this kid had made serious progress in the last few years.

And then…

His gaze dropped to Lu Yuan's feet. Eight spirit rings gleamed in formation—two of them a deep crimson that made Dugu Bo's jaw nearly hit the ground. Two hundred-thousand-year spirit rings?!

As a Title Douluo, he knew just how impossible it was to obtain even one of those. And this brat had two.

Not only that—the first six rings had all turned to obsidian black, not the purple they'd been five years ago. With such a lineup, if Lu Yuan was truly a Soul Saint, he could easily dominate ordinary Contras.

And Lu Yuan wasn't just carrying rings—Dugu Bo could sense multiple powerful spirit bones as well. Something about this… didn't add up.

Several more Sword Qi slashed through the air, forcing Dugu Bo back a step.

"Fifth Soul Ability—Snake Emperor Break!"

Emerald light surged from Dugu Bo's fingers, the energy compressing rapidly as it flew and twisting the air around it.

"Third Soul Skill—Sword Formation!"

Above the forest canopy, thousands of tiny points materialized, condensing into dark, razor-sharp blades under Lu Yuan's command.

Whhhh—

The storm of blades streamed down like a deadly rain.

The moment steel met green light, the collision detonated into poisonous fog, blanketing thirty meters in seconds.

Within moments, the blades blackened, corroded, and crumbled to mist under the toxic assault. The plants nearby shriveled and rotted instantly.

That one exchange told Dugu Bo everything he needed to know: this kid was dangerous.

With two amplification skills running, Lu Yuan's aura rose to a level nearly matching a Title Douluo.

"Seventh Soul Ability—Martial Soul True Body!"

A towering black sword shadow erupted behind Lu Yuan, merging seamlessly with the weapon in his hand. Terrifying power crashed forward toward Dugu Bo like a wave.

"The Seventh Soul Ability—Jade Snake Emperor True Body!"

Emerald light exploded from Dugu Bo's form, his tall, thin silhouette swelling into that of a massive upright cobra. Twin green eyes locked onto Lu Yuan.

Even Dugu Bo knew he was in trouble. The moment Lu Yuan's true body activated, the surge in strength was overwhelming—if he didn't unleash his own Martial Soul, he'd be crushed outright.

The thought flickered through his mind: Can't let this brat get away with this any longer.

And with that, the clash truly began.
